Best High Schools in Mascoutah, IL

Mascoutah, IL has 3 high schools with 2,064 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in Mascoutah score 28%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 31%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in Mascoutah meet expectations.

Best Middle Schools in Mascoutah, IL

Mascoutah, IL has 4 middle schools with 1,601 students. Below are the top middle sch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, middle schools in Mascoutah score 43%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 38%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, middle schools in Mascoutah greatly exceed expectations.

Best Elementary Schools in Mascoutah, IL

Mascoutah, IL has 3 elementary schools with 1,189 students. Below are the top elementary sch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, elementary schools in Mascoutah score 45%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 36%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, elementary schools in Mascoutah greatly ex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Mascoutah, IL

City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Mascoutah, IL has a total population of 9,454 with 29%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 96%, and 30%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
